Key Bible Verses That Speak Against Fear

Let’s delve into some powerful verses that remind us of the importance of overcoming fear.

1. Isaiah 41:10

“So do not fear, for I am with you; do not be dismayed, for I am your God. I will strengthen you and help you; I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.”

This verse highlights the assurance that God is always by our side. When we feel overwhelmed, we can find strength in the fact that He is there to support us.

2. 2 Timothy 1:7

“For God has not given us a spirit of fear, but of power, love, and a sound mind.”

In this passage, Paul reminds us that fear is not part of God’s design for our lives. Instead, He empowers us with love and a clear mind, equipping us to face challenges with confidence.

3. Psalm 34:4

"I sought the Lord, and he answered me; he delivered me from all my fears."

This verse emphasizes the act of seeking God as a solution to our fears. His willingness to deliver us can inspire us to place our worries in His hands.

4. Joshua 1:9

“Have I not commanded you? Be strong and courageous. Do not be afraid; do not be discouraged, for the Lord your God will be with you wherever you go.”

Here, God commands Joshua to embrace strength and courage, a message that reverberates through time as a reminder for all believers that God’s presence is constant, no matter the circumstances.

5. Romans 8:31

“If God is for us, who can be against us?”

This powerful statement serves as a bold declaration of faith. It encourages believers to face their fears head-on, confident that God is on their side.

Practical Ways to Apply These Verses in Daily Life

Understanding these verses is just the beginning. Here are some practical ways to apply them to your daily routine:

  • Meditate on Scripture: Take time each day to read and reflect on these verses. Journaling your thoughts and feelings can help reinforce their message.
  • Pray Regularly: Use prayer as a means to express your fears to God. Ask for courage and strength to overcome those worries.
  • Surround Yourself with Support: Engage with community or fellow believers who uplift you. Sometimes, having a support system can shift your focus and reduce anxiety.
  • Practice Gratitude: Shift your mindset by focusing on what you are thankful for. This can counterbalance feelings of fear and promote a sense of peace.

Mindfulness Techniques

In addition to spiritual practices, consider integrating mindfulness techniques into your daily routine, such as:

  • Deep Breathing: In moments of panic, deep breathing exercises can help calm your mind and body.
  • Visualization: Picture a peaceful place or situation, reinforcing feelings of safety and comfort.
  • Affirmations: Use positive affirmations that align with the scriptures to help remind yourself of the truth of God’s promises.
